About This Property
It's about location in Covington! Experience Mainstrasse living in this inviting 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om apartment, taking up the entire second floor of a well-kept building. Bright with natural light, the apartment's interior is a cozy, welcoming space. The kitchen boasts a dishwasher, garbage disposal, and a new refrigerator, along with a handy island that offers extra counter space and seating, perfect for quick meals. Convenience is key here, as the apartment features an in-unit washer & dryer as well as central air conditioning and heat. Located in the lively Mainstrasse Village, this home is perfectly situated in the dynamic areas of Mainstrasse Village and Madison Avenue. In both directions, you'll find a variety of restaurants, shops, and entertainment options, making it the perfect spot in Covington for those who love the Cov. 1 year lease. Owner pays for water, trash and sanitation. Tennant pays for electricity. There is no gas at this property. No subletting allowed. Small and medium well behaved pets are allowed. Pet deposit $300 no monthly increase.

Nestled in the northern portion of the city, Downtown Covington is home to the central business district along with a slew of cultural and recreational amenities. Madison Avenue brims with vintage charm, with colorful buildings in a diverse range of architectural stylings containing numerous specialty shops, entertainment venues, and local restaurants serving international cuisine.
Many of Downtown Covington’s buildings are adorned with vibrant murals painted by local and international artists. Goebel Park is also located in the area, offering traditional park amenities like a public pool and playground as well as a German-style Carroll Chimes Clock Tower, which displays a charming puppet show of the Pied Piper every hour.
